Qatar Shipping buys large LNG carrier Milaha Ras Laffan

Mon Jul 06 10:20:56 CEST 2015 arnekiel

Qatar Shipping Company, part of Milaha, has acquired the remaining 60% interests in two LNG carriers for an undisclosed sum from French bank Société Générale. The Korean-built vessels Milaha Ras Laffan (138,273 cbm, built 2004) and Milaha Qatar (145,602 cbm, built 2006) are currently both on 25-year timecharters to RasGas, with 14 years and 16 years remaining on their respective contracts.

The "Mærsk Ras Laffan" rescued six Iranian sailors whose ship had sunk in the Gulf of Persia on Aug 12. 2010. At 8.27 a.m. an object was sighted in rough seas and short time later an SOS-flag sighted. The crew of the distressed vessel started to throw cargo over board in order to lighten the ship. The "Mærsk Ras Laffan" launched a boat and took the crew aboard.
